TRANSMED First Come First Served Offer 2026-27

TRANSMED First Come First Served Offer 2026-27

(hereinafter the “Offer”)

TRANSMED informs that the firm transportation capacity on the offshore pipeline system across the Strait of Sicily, from the Cap Bon delivery point to the Mazara del Vallo redelivery point, which remained uncommitted after TRANSMED’s previous offers, is available from June 23rd, 2026 on the PRISMA platform, on a “first come first served” basis.

The capacity products offered are:

  • Gas Year 2026/27 and multiples thereof;
  • Calendar Year 2027 and multiples thereof;
  • Quarters of Gas Year 2026/27 (Q4 2026, Q1, Q2 and Q3 2027);
  • Months of Gas Year 2026/27;
  • BOM - Balance of Months of Gas Year 2026/27 (all remaining days of a Month);
  • Weeks (7 days Sat-Fri or Sun-Sat) of Gas Year 2026/27;
  • Week Working Days (5 days Mon-Fri) of Gas Year 2026/27;
  • Weekends (2 days Sat-Sun) of Gas Year 2026/27;
  • Days-ahead (up to 3 days: D+1, D+2 and D+3) of Gas Year 2026/27.

In addition, the Modulation Service on a weekly and on a monthly basis, already included in TRANSMED’s FCFS 2025/26 Offer, will remain available.

As with previous TRANSMED offers, the Offer provides for a coordinated and linked allocation of capacity on both TTPC and TMPC transportation systems, and the booking process for bundled TTPC/TRANSMED transportation capacity is entirely managed through the PRISMA platform. Interested parties will find TTPC terms and conditions at www.ttpc.sea-corridor.com.

Please be informed that the above mentioned available transportation capacity does not include the corresponding capacity at the Mazara del Vallo entry point on the Snam Rete Gas network system.
